Coy, Sc.D. is a biologist and cancer researcher who discovered the TKTL1 metabolism route. While working at the renowned German Cancer Research Center in Heidelberg he made that discovery. He then founded a pharmaceutical company and two diagnostic companies to utilise his knowledge about the TKTL1 gene and begin development of new cancer therapies and tests. Maren Franz has a degree in pharmaceutical studies and journalism. She is an author and cancer survivor.
